from PyQt5.QtGui import *
from electrum.i18n import _
import datetime
from collections import defaultdict
from electrum.util import format_satoshis
from electrum.bitcoin import COIN
import matplotlib
matplotlib.use('Qt5Agg')
import matplotlib.pyplot as plt
import matplotlib.dates as md
from matplotlib.patches import Ellipse
from matplotlib.offsetbox import AnchoredOffsetbox, TextArea, DrawingArea, HPacker
def plot_history(wallet, history):
hist_in = defaultdict(int)
hist_out = defaultdict(int)
for item in history:
tx_hash, height, confirmations, timestamp, value, balance = item
if not confirmations:
continue
if timestamp is None:
continue
value = value*1./COIN
date = datetime.datetime.fromtimestamp(timestamp)
datenum = int(md.date2num(datetime.date(date.year, date.month, 1)))
if value > 0:
hist_in[datenum] += value
else:
hist_out[datenum] -= value
f, axarr = plt.subplots(2, sharex=True)
plt.subplots_adjust(bottom=0.2)
plt.xticks( rotation=25 )
ax = plt.gca()
plt.ylabel('BTC')
plt.xlabel('Month')
xfmt = md.DateFormatter('%Y-%m-%d')
ax.xaxis.set_major_formatter(xfmt)
axarr[0].set_title('Monthly Volume')
xfmt = md.DateFormatter('%Y-%m')
ax.xaxis.set_major_formatter(xfmt)
width = 20
dates, values = zip(*sorted(hist_in.items()))
r1 = axarr[0].bar(dates, values, width, label='incoming')
axarr[0].legend(loc='upper left')
dates, values = zip(*sorted(hist_out.items()))
r2 = axarr[1].bar(dates, values, width, color='r', label='outgoing')
axarr[1].legend(loc='upper left')
return plt
